What Is Operational Excellence?
Operational excellence refers to the pursuit of continuous improvement in processes, quality, and efficiency to achieve superior performance and create value for customers. It involves aligning operational strategies with business objectives and leveraging best practices to drive sustainable growth. The goal is to enhance productivity, reduce waste, and deliver high-quality products or services consistently.
The Role of Stakeholder Collaboration
Stakeholders are individuals or groups with an interest in the company’s activities, including employees, customers, suppliers, investors, and the community. Effective stakeholder collaboration involves engaging these parties in meaningful ways to align their interests with the company’s goals. Here’s why collaboration is crucial:
1. Enhanced Problem-Solving: Diverse perspectives from various stakeholders can lead to innovative solutions and better decision-making.
2. Increased Efficiency: Collaborative efforts can streamline processes and eliminate redundancies, improving overall efficiency.
3. Stronger Relationships: Building trust and understanding with stakeholders fosters long-term partnerships and loyalty.
4. Risk Mitigation: Early engagement with stakeholders helps identify potential risks and address them proactively.
Strategies for Effective Stakeholder Collaboration
To leverage stakeholder collaboration for operational excellence, consider the following strategies:
1. Identify Key Stakeholders: Begin by mapping out who your key stakeholders are. This includes anyone who can impact or be impacted by your operations. Understanding their needs, expectations, and influence is critical for effective collaboration.
2. Communicate Transparently: Open and honest communication is the foundation of successful collaboration. Regular updates, feedback sessions, and transparent discussions help build trust and keep stakeholders informed about progress and challenges.
3. Align Objectives: Ensure that the goals and objectives of your stakeholders are aligned with your operational goals. This alignment helps in creating a shared vision and ensures that everyone is working towards common objectives.
4. Foster a Collaborative Culture: Encourage a culture of collaboration within your organization. Promote teamwork, recognize contributions, and provide platforms for stakeholders to collaborate effectively. Tools like collaborative software and regular team meetings can facilitate this process.
5. Implement Feedback Loops: Establish mechanisms for gathering and acting on stakeholder feedback. Regularly review and adjust strategies based on input from stakeholders to ensure continuous improvement and responsiveness to their needs.
6. Measure and Evaluate Performance: Track the performance of your collaborative efforts through key performance indicators (KPIs) and metrics. Evaluate the effectiveness of your strategies and make necessary adjustments to improve outcomes.
Real-World Examples
Case Study 1: Toyota
Toyota’s success in operational excellence is partly due to its focus on stakeholder collaboration. The company works closely with suppliers to ensure high-quality materials and efficient supply chain processes. Regular feedback and joint problem-solving sessions have contributed to Toyota’s reputation for reliability and innovation.
Case Study 2: Starbucks
Starbucks engages with its stakeholders through initiatives like ethical sourcing and community involvement. By collaborating with farmers, customers, and local communities, Starbucks not only enhances its operational practices but also strengthens its brand loyalty and social impact.
